 ABOUT THE WEBINAR

During times of change and pressure, organisations look to their Board for guidance and leadership. This session will examine what a prudent Board should be doing to steer its organisation through stormy waters resulting from the pandemic, royal commission findings, increasing regulation and the economic downturn, including:

  • Is the Board comprised of the right people to make the right decisions?
  • Board duties and responsibilities under the microscope: Australian Security Investment Commission v Mitchell (No 2) [2020] FCA 1098
  • Purpose as the guiding light: ensuring alignment between organisational objectives and operations
  • Does the board know what it needs to know? Financial and other reporting obligations
  • Conducting self -assessment and reviews of structure, activities and performance
  • Bringing in the experts
  • Putting risk management on the front footing, including new industrial manslaughter laws
  • Essential items for every Board meeting agenda

Alistair is the Managing Director of Corney & Lind Lawyers. He was admitted as a legal practitioner of the Supreme Court of the Australian Capital Territory in 2001 and has experience in the ACT, NSW and QLD jurisdictions.  Prior to working in private practice, he was also a solicitor with the Australian Federal Police and a criminal prosecutor.

Alistair is responsible for leading the Firm’s litigation and dispute resolution teams, and in this capacity regularly advises school leaders and boards on the range of legal issues they confront.  He has a particular focus on industrial relations and discrimination disputes. 

Separately to his legal practice, he is currently a board member of Queensland Baptists, an entity responsible for the governance of various schools throughout Queensland.  In this role, he has also been a part of the steering committee responsible for preparing the response of the QB Movement to the National Redress Scheme.
